Totara Lagoon
Totara Lagoon is a lagoon in West Coast, South Island. Totara Lagoon is situated nearby to the hamlet Ruatapu, as well as near the locality Portage Landing.- Type: Lagoon
- Description: lagoon in West Coast Region, New Zealand
- Also known as: “Totara Lagoon (West Coast)”
